About The Great Brady Street Bike Race

Date: 6/23/22

Location: NOMAD on Brady

Tour of America’s Dairyland (ToAD), the largest competitive road cycling series in the U.S., is making its first appearance on the storied streets of Brady Street this year. This 7 corner, 1 mile long criterium is destined to be one of the most exciting bike races in America! 

The proceeds of the race will support the efforts of ADHD America, a 501(c)(3) non-profit organization, who’s mission it is to assist the 7 million school-aged children in America who struggle with this disorder. 

In order to successfully operate the day-long event, 60 volunteers are needed throughout the day to manage race-day activities. We need your help as a volunteer for this event!

Each volunteer commitment entails a 2-hour investment of your time. Activities will include, managing crosswalks, intersection barriers, and course setup and take down. Each volunteer receives a pass to the NOMAD Pig Roast BBQ and two beverages of your choice.
